Qarsi High Priest

B · Creature — Human Cleric

{1}{B}, {T}, Sacrifice another creature: Manifest the top card of your library. (Put that card onto the battlefield face down as a 2/2 creature. Turn it face up any time for its mana cost if it's a creature card.) 0/2
